Noodle Bowls with Chile Lime Dressing Recipe

Chicken:
2 Tbsp soy sauce
2 Tbsp vegetable oil
1 tsp sugar
Garlic
Ginger
4 boneless skinless chicken breast

Mix soy sauce, oil, sugar, garlic and ginger together, pour over chicken. Marinade overnight.

Chile Lime Dressing (can be made night before):
½ cup hot water
¼ cup sugar
¼ cup unseasoned rice vinegar
¼ cup fish sauce
1 to 2 Tbsp lime juice
1 to 2 Tbsp minced red or green jalapenos

Mix hot water and sugar, then adding rice vinegar, fish sauce, lime juice and jalapenos; set aside.

Noodle Bowls:
1 (6 oz) package angel hair pasta
Shredded carrots
½ cup cilantro
½ cup mint leaves
Crushed peanuts
Lettuce/bok choy
Cucumber
Bean sprouts
Green onions
Toasted sesame seeds
Lime wedges

Slice and dice vegetables, place into separate bowls. Grill chicken, cut into strips and set aside on a plate. While chicken is cooking, cook noodles, drain and place into a bowl. To serve, allow each person to assemble their own combination of ingredients and add dressing.

Janelle provided this bowl sample: Lettuce/bok choy, topped with cooked noodles, then chicken, then the herbs, veggies, toasted sesame seeds & peanuts. Add juice from a lime wedge (optional) and some dressing.
